The Assistant Project Manager will be a member of VBC's U.S. Project Delivery Team. In this role you will assist with managing the development and execution of a project(s) from early design through manufacturing. Starting with the design phase, you will work cross-functionally with internal departments and stakeholders to help turn the concept into reality. You will use project management tools, processes, and best practice methodologies to assist in the management scope, schedule, and cost.
This role is ideal for someone with foundational experience in the AEC or manufacturing sectors who is ready to take the next step in their career. You’ll work alongside project managers and cross-functional teams to support the delivery of innovative modular construction projects. The role offers hands-on exposure to the full project lifecycle and is a great opportunity for someone who thrives in a fast-paced environment, is highly organized, and is eager to grow into a leadership position over time.
